Taiwan 2022. Best Selling Cars Ranking: Toyota Dominates With 5 Models In Top 10
Taiwan Best Selling Cars ranking of 2022 reports the Toyota Corolla Cross conquering the throne and rising 71.7% from the previous year. Toyota secures 5 models in the top 10.
Taiwan 2022. Vehicles Market Reports Lowest Sales Since 2015
Taiwanese Vehicles Market in 2022 totals 415,597 sales, the lowest since 2015 and a 4.0% decrease from the prior year. In December sales grew 5.2%, with 41,188 new registrations.
Taiwan 2021. Best selling cars ranking
Taiwan Best Selling Cars ranking in 2021 reports a the Toyota Rav4 holding the throne with 5.3% market share. Meanwhile, the Toyota Corolla Cross rises in second position, jumping 12 spots.
Taiwan 2021. CMC Keeps Outperforming A Market Down 1.1%
Taiwan's car market in 2021 falls by 1.1% with 449,859 sales, reporting a very strong Q1, but reported a drop in sales all other quarters. CMC reports the best performance this year, gaining 114.8%, while Mitsubishi drops 55.2%.
Taiwan 2020. Best selling cars ranking
Taiwan Best Selling Cars ranking in 2020 reports a new leader after decades of Toyota Corolla domination. In fact, the Toyota Rav4 takes the throne with 7.5% market share. Meanwhile, the Mitsubishi Fuso enters the leaderboard, jumping 26 spots to reach 10th position.
Taiwan 2020. Mitsubishi doubles sales (+117.7%) in market growing 3.5%
Taiwanese vehicle market in 2020 gains 3.5% despite the pandemic and restrictions. Full-Year sales have been 451.235. Mitsubishi impresses by jumping 5 spots and increasing sales by 117.7%.

Taiwan 2019. Toyota recovering share in a positive market (+1.3%)
Taiwanese Vehicles Sales in 2019 held a positive trend. Indeed, Total sales have been 438.145, up 1.3%, while December registered 43.430 units. Toyota started to recover market share while Honda immediately lost the 2nd place, falling in double-digits.
Taiwan best selling cars. The Top 50 of 2018
Taiwan Best Selling Cars ranking in 2018 was again dominated by the Toyota Corolla - despite the fall by 30% - while the Toyota Rav-4 gained the second place ahead of the Honda CR-V. Impressive performance registered by the Mazda CX-5, joining the Top10.
